Who Should Rent Holiday Houses and Homes in Port Douglas?

Perfect Destinations for Every Type of Traveler

Port Douglas attracts adventure seekers who crave world-class snorkeling and diving experiences at the Great Barrier Reef, with luxury holiday homes in Port Douglas providing the perfect retreat after underwater explorations. Families find this destination irresistible for its calm Four Mile Beach, where children can safely play while parents relax under the tropical sun. Couples seeking romance are drawn to the town's sophisticated dining scene along Macrossan Street and sunset sailing excursions from Crystalbrook Marina. Nature enthusiasts revel in guided tours through the ancient Daintree Rainforest, where they can spot cassowaries and exotic wildlife just minutes from their accommodation. The optimal time to visit is during the dry season from May to October, when temperatures range from 22-27°C and rainfall is minimal, though this period commands premium pricing with average nightly rates reaching A$940-1,400. The wet season from November to April offers more affordable rates around A$660-800 per night, with temperatures soaring to 29-34°C and afternoon thunderstorms providing dramatic tropical atmosphere.

Wildlife Habitat Port Douglas

This award-winning wildlife sanctuary provides intimate encounters with native Australian animals in their natural habitats, featuring koalas, crocodiles, and tropical birds across wetlands, rainforest, and savanna environments.

Four Mile Beach Scenic Walk

Stretch along this pristine sandy coastline that offers safe swimming, stunning mountain backdrops, and perfect sunrise photography opportunities, with convenient beach access from most holiday accommodations.

Daintree Rainforest Discovery Centre

Explore the world's oldest surviving tropical rainforest through elevated walkways and canopy towers, where visitors can spot ancient flora and diverse wildlife in this UNESCO World Heritage site.

Great Barrier Reef Snorkeling Tours

Embark on day trips to outer reef sites like Agincourt Reef, where crystal-clear waters reveal vibrant coral gardens and tropical fish species in one of the world's seven natural wonders.

Flagstaff Hill Lighthouse Sunset Views

Climb to this historic lighthouse for panoramic views over the Coral Sea and Port Douglas marina, offering spectacular sunset photography and insight into the region's maritime heritage.

Essential Local Insights for Port Douglas Visitors

Insider Tips for the Perfect Tropical Getaway

Local hosts consistently recommend booking Great Barrier Reef tours well in advance, particularly during peak season from May to October when weather conditions are optimal for snorkeling and diving excursions. The town operates a complimentary shuttle bus service that connects holiday accommodation areas with the main shopping precinct along Macrossan Street, making car-free exploration both convenient and environmentally conscious.

Port Douglas takes sustainability seriously, with many holiday homes to rent in Port Douglas featuring solar heating systems, rainwater collection, and native plant landscaping that supports local wildlife corridors. The region's unique geography creates distinct microclimates, so guests should pack both lightweight clothing for beach activities and warmer layers for air-conditioned restaurants and morning rainforest excursions.

Local markets operate every Sunday at Anzac Park, where visitors can purchase fresh tropical fruits, artisanal crafts, and regional delicacies directly from producers. Stinger season runs from October to May, requiring protective clothing or stinger suits when swimming at Four Mile Beach, though most luxury holiday homes in Port Douglas with private pools provide year-round safe swimming alternatives for families and couples seeking tropical relaxation.
